Webb11 apr. 2024 · Landscape design plans cost $700 to $3,000. ... and basic sketches from a nursery horticulturist. These fees include designing gardens from 600 to 1,000 square feet, without installation. ... A landscape architect costs $100 to $250 per hour minimum and must have a degree. Webb2 okt. 2024 · We found that 62.7% of landscape designers have graduated with a bachelor's degree and 9.0% of people in this position have earned their master's degrees. While most landscape designers have a college degree, you may find it's also true that generally it's possible to be successful in this career with only a high school degree. Webb1. WebbOne option is working with a landscape contractor 1st then getting your landscape contractors license and then pursuing a degree and landscape license after that. It’s an alternate route but will give you a ton of practical knowledge that will be useful and also make your designs at school more practical than your average peer.
